Italian WWII Helmet & Military Stencils: Alpini (Military School) ERA cross strapsNew Made Item: Reproduction steel Stencil replicating Military Equipment, Helmet and Unit Stencils of Mussolini? s Armed Forces from WW2. Used extensively in the North African Campaigns and in Italy's attempts at recreating the Roman Empire in Southern Europe during the 1930s and 1940s. Each measures approximately 4? x 4?. Eight varieties available as follows: a) Light Artillery (MS2000) b) Alpine Artillery (MS2001) c) Royal Army Paratroopers (MS2002)
